How to Choose Weathering Steel Garden Edging
Selecting the right edging starts with your layout and the level of restraint you need in the garden. Measure the run length, note any curves, and decide whether you want a clean linear border or a more natural, flowing edge. Consider the height that best suits your planting: taller edging helps separate mulch from pathways, while corten garden edging lower profiles suit edging along planting beds. Since weathering steel develops a protective surface over time, it’s a strong option for outdoor durability and a distinctive, earthy appearance. For a long-lasting result, also check the steel gauge and the fastening method recommended for your installation style.
Plan the Layout and Prepare the Ground
Before any cutting or fixing, mark the boundary using string lines, hoses, or spray paint. For curved shapes, use flexible layout tools and adjust the radius to match your desired look. Then remove grass and weeds along the line, and dig a shallow trench to sit the steel edge securely. A compacted base steel edge garden improves stability: use a suitable bedding material and ensure the trench depth matches the height of the steel so the finished edge looks level. Take time to confirm alignment from multiple angles, as small shifts become noticeable once the edging is installed and filled around.
Install for Strength, Drainage, and a Neat Finish
When fitting a border, keep the top line consistent and allow the base to contact firmly. Use corrosion-resistant fixings appropriate for the edging design, and anchor at regular intervals—especially on bends and corners. Backfill carefully, compacting soil or gravel around the base to prevent movement. If you’re edging against a lawn, consider a tighter fit and a clean top line to reduce gaps where grass can creep in. For planting beds, leave room for mulch and soil build-up so the border remains tidy and functional. After installation, check that the edge holds firm and that water can drain naturally without undermining the base.
